Transaction 9827156bb28c378df615f9f3c56cdc032f1e7ace1dcd094eb3f2a51be2402667

1 Input
2 Outputs
  • 9827156bb28c378df615f9f3c56cdc032f1e7ace1dcd094eb3f2a51be2402667:0
  • value  12357120
    address  1C6uxCZkotRGcqsMvRAZfSYTnnZQNxZSTV
  • 9827156bb28c378df615f9f3c56cdc032f1e7ace1dcd094eb3f2a51be2402667:1
  • value  5252880
    address  1NrwdPo1ysVGAQWxjym6Gp17DbHsN4Yt9